Bread, high protein, toasted has the most protein of the foods compared, at 13.3 g per 100g.

Nutrient Bread, raisin Bread, high protein, toasted Bread, wheat or cracked wheat, made…
Protein 8.8 G13.3 G10.3 G
Total lipid (fat) 3.3 G2.4 G3.7 G
Carbohydrate, by difference 52.2 G48.1 G49.2 G
Energy 270 KCAL269 KCAL271 KCAL
Total Sugars 11.3 G1.6 G3.2 G
Fiber, total dietary 2.5 G3.3 G3.4 G
Calcium, Ca 196 MG136 MG42 MG
Iron, Fe 3.2 MG4.6 MG3.2 MG
Potassium, K 180 MG354 MG170 MG
Sodium, Na 408 MG444 MG576 MG
Cholesterol 0 MG0 MG4 MG
Fatty acids, total saturated 0.75 G0.36 G1.2 G
